Arkansas Baseball Set to Scrimmage Friday at 6 p.m.

FAYETTEVILLE, Ark. – The Arkansas baseball team will hold a major-public scrimmage on Friday, Sept. 28, beginning at 6 p.m. from Baum Stadium.

The nine- or 10-inning scrimmage, which is open to the public, will feature two evenly divided teams to give the Razorback fans another look at the 2008 Diamond Hogs.

The Hogs return six starting position players along with pitchers Shaun Seibert, Dallas Keuchel, Travis Hill, Stephen Richards and Evan Cox.

It will also be a chance to get a sneak peak at Head Coach Dave Van Horn’s newcomers. The 20-man incoming class includes seven players that have turned down professional contracts to play for the Razorbacks.

Arkansas first scrimmage of the fall, which took place last Friday, saw the Razorbacks combine for three home runs and eight extra-base hits. The Hogs also got solid pitching performances from Richards, sophomore-transfer Mike Bolsinger and sophomore Chad Pierce.
